Course Description
Learning HTML can be a valuable skill for anyone interested in web development or design. A full course in HTML will typically cover the basics of coding, including elements, tags, attributes, and syntax. Students will also learn how to create a basic web page using HTML, as well as how to link pages together and add images and multimedia content.
Some key features of an HTML full course may include:
1. Introduction to HTML: Understanding the basics of HTML, including how it is used in web development and the structure of an HTML document.
2. Elements and Tags: Learning about HTML elements and tags, how to use them to structure content on a web page, and the different types of tags available.
3. Attributes: Understanding how attributes are used in HTML to provide additional information about elements, such as linking to external pages or adding images.
4. Forms and Input: Exploring how to create forms in HTML for user interaction, including text fields, buttons, and dropdown menus.
5. Multimedia Content: Learning how to embed images, videos, and audio files into an HTML document, as well as how to control their display.
Overall, a comprehensive HTML course will provide students with the knowledge and skills needed to create and modify web pages using HTML code.
